In this paper we study sphere coverage issue. A sphere of radius one in a $3$-dimensional Euclidean space is given. We consider random location of \textit{N} spherical caps on a sphere, assuming that $N$ is a discrete stochastic variable with a Poisson distribution. Using suitable difference equation, the expected area of the covered region is investigated.
